At the same time as TV 2 interviewed a depressed Ingrid Serstad Engin in the interview area of ​​the AMEX stadium, a “strong enough” sounded as a group of Austrian players aimed at the press conference door.

There they rehearsed Erin Foreman’s meeting with the press by dancing and singing around the podium.

– I am very proud of the team. I don’t have the right word for it yet. It was just a very impressive team performance, Austria star Sarah Zadrazil told TV 2, having secured the quarter-finals at the expense of Norway.

– I’m just proud and I think no one else nominated us, but now we go to the quarter-finals. It’s a dream come true.

Austria and Arsenal goalkeeper Manuela Zinsberger received only one shot from Norway in the crucial match in Brighton.

– Sometimes you don’t need world-class players in a team, Austrian cage keeper tells TV 2.

– It’s about mentality, that you know that man has no limits. I am proud of the mentality we brought with us to the field. We didn’t need many chances, but we took them and that was enough.

In its second-ever European Championship, Austria moved from the group stage to the quarter-finals.

Five years ago, it was a success when Austria beat Spain after a penalty shootout in the quarter-finals. Germany is now waiting in Brentford next Thursday.

– We’re proud to be here at all. We are a small country, we just wanted to show what it means to play as a team, says Zadrazil.

-this is unbelievable. I’m ready for the quarter-finals! Whatever comes up, it’s a bonus.
